    Sports rap
Did , you see those incredible
fights that were televised by ABC
late in March? They are probably
still helping Tate out of the ring.
Although Weaver fought a good
fight against Tate, there is no
way he is going to beat Holmes.
Every time I watch Sugar-Ray
Leonard, I am more amazed than
ever, he has to have the fastest
hands of any boxer in the game
today. At this point, I would pick
Sugar-Ray over Robert Duran if
this fight materializes. Eddie
Gregory could have knocked out
Marvin Johnson a lot earlier if he
did not wait until the 11th round to
start punching. How could such a
physical specimen as Leroy
Jones get to fight Larry Holmes?
If Jones is rated in the top 10
heavyweight onctenders, I would
hate to see the men that are rank
ed below him. I think ABC put
this fight on last as a kind of com
ic relief.
I hope Ali does not decide to
return to the ring. The man does
not need the money that bad, he
could make half of that by public
appearances. Remember what
happened to Joe Louis when he

The Louisville-UCLA NCAA
Championship game was one in
which the fans did not leave ear
ly. Although Griffith did not have
his typical super game, the Car
dinals still came back from a late
fourth quarter deficit. The Boston
Celtics have the first pick again
in the college draft. That makes it
two years straight that Boston
has drafted the top college pick.
Look for Boston to either draft
7'4" Ralph Sampson from the
University of Virginia, if he
decides to go hardships, or Dar
rel Griffith from Louisville.
From the cellar to the top in two
years, what an incredible turn
around.
Now it's time for my first an
nual hockey, basketball and soc
cer predictions. First of all, in
hockey, look for Montreal to take
it again, although the Sabres,
Rangers, Islanders and Flyers
might have something to say
about it. In the NBA, look for the
Celtics to win the crown, although
by Scott Semmel
the Sixer's look tough, as do the
Lakers; the Celtics are just too
awesome. As far as soccer goes, I
have to go with the Cosmos. They
purchased two superstars in
Oscar and Romero and have just
recently bought Francois Van der
Elst who will not jion the team
until around the Bth game of the
season. Vancouver probably will
not be as tough as last year, since
much dissension has surrounded
the team ever since the Soccer
Bowl last year.
Still cannot believe the Olym
pics, especially the Gold Medal
play of our hockey team. Jim
Craig looked really sharp in goal
for Atlanta in his NHL debut.
However, all the pressure and
travel, have finally caught up to
the Olympic hero. He has taken
the rest of the season off, in order
to recover from the flu and to get
his head together. Jim Craig has
the potential to be an all-star
goalie in the NHL, if he is brought
along at the proper speed.
However, look for Craig to be
traded in the off-season, and keep
in mind that the Boston Bruins
are in serious need of net
minders.

The recently formed campus
newsletter, Vortex, published
monthly by the Speculative Fic
tion Club, has created a whirlpool
of interest among SF members
and Science Fiction buffs alike.
The newsletter, edited by Drew
Coffman, who, by the way,
thought of the title Vortex, and
Dave, Wetzel, will be publishing
its third issue in May.
Vortex is the second such
newsletter available to
Highacres students. The other is
the Student Affairs Office's
Communique published bi
monthly.
